What is Me Reverte?
1.
Definitions:
'Contact me'
'Get back to me later'
Origins:
Comes from the spanish verb 'revertir' meaning 'to revert (to)', and literally means "revert to me".
Usage:
This can be used in informal speech among friends but also in business letters/conversation.
Examples:
(1) In a letter or note:
"If you need any more help, me revirte"
(2) In a telephone conversation:
Person A: "Hi, can you talk?"
Person B: "No, sorry I'm really busy."
Person A: "No problem. Me reverte?"
Person B: "OK, I'll call you later. Bye."
